Output e8e375658466ba353905af30087d2169ba087379328be582d4fbe0e357581942:893

value
1590
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 124c86473f4afbfce1de0aedec4617e25f44ed2032e2c6a21682fd20b31b8012
address
bc1pzfxgv3elftalecw7ptk7c3shuf05fmfqxt3vdgskst7jpvcmsqfqmz2vdc
transaction
e8e375658466ba353905af30087d2169ba087379328be582d4fbe0e357581942
spent
true